Are you the creator/part of the team? I can understand you are trying to defend your work but lets be honest here:

The medieval 2 engine is a dumbed down version of the one RTW had. Units are missing a lot of stats that were helpful in their balancing, such as unit lethality to help rhompaiophoroi and other units that were meant to take out heavily armored units. In EB2 right now because of this units take fucking forever to die, very boring.
Then there is the issue of units with projectiles being unable to charge on command, they have to throw their projectiles first so if you are also getting charged those units are defenseless.

Other than that, I admire that EB2 has removed a lot of the fantasy units EB1 had, of course they are still missing a lot of the historical units EB1 had. The mod also is smoother simply because of the newer engine, although it is inferior to RTW's.
